CONVERSATION Any updates on the future of the Doctor Who Collection Blu-rays using Ai?
First to describe what I am posting about, here is a comparison video example between the dvd and blu-ray ranges of Doctor Who
So apparently there is a private forum thread via GallifreyBase specifically addressing and discussing the use of Ai on the Collection Blu-ray sets, with account members either part of, or connected to the Restoration Team working on the range exchanging messages back and forth in much more detail.
Unfortunately I myself have no way of registering to GallifreyBase (their account registration system's been busted for years) and as I write this I do not know anyone with an existing account that could help publicize this specific thread.
The reason I ask this is because I believe without this critical information from the Restoration Team being public, it continues to leave the Collection range on an awkward precipice for many of us fans and collectors. Already since Seasons 13 + 21 plenty of online posts and video reviews have questioned the over-use of Ai, but without any information sources from within the Restoration Team that could help best explain the technical goings on under the hood - how much is Topaz Ai affecting the digitized master tapes, how much is DNR (digital noise reduction) or De-Haloing affecting the final outputs, and if so, what are the justifications? Are all the raw digitized master tapes *that bad* under the hood without these algorithmic alterations? What is the native before and after picture quality with proper and crucial technical context?
Have any further discussions within GallifreyBase by the Restoration Team disclosed the future use, refinement of (or removal of) Ai + digital enhancements to the picture quality? Will there be future 'revisitation' sets similar to the special edition dvds where different / improved digital techniques were used (and any/most errors corrected) have the BBC themselves contacted the Restoration Team with regards to the Ai backlash across several shopping outlets and social media / fandom?
At the present, nobody on the outside can genuinely say they know what is or isn't going on with the restoration process, except that it is just so jarringly different with zero technical explanation of the digitizing process by the Restoration Team.
